About the Role:

We are currently seeking an experienced Recruitment / Mobilisation Administrator to provide temporary support across recruitment and mobilisation functions. This is a dynamic, fast-paced role requiring someone who can confidently manage high volumes of candidates while ensuring mobilisation processes are completed accurately and on time.

 

You will play a key role in coordinating candidate onboarding, supporting recruitment activities, and liaising closely with both internal teams and external candidates to ensure smooth mobilisation outcomes across multiple projects.

 

Key Responsibilities:

  • Coordinate end-to-end mobilisation processes for personnel across multiple projects
  • Assist with recruitment activities including candidate screening, phone liaison, and onboarding support
  • Manage and update mobilisation trackers, systems, and documentation
  • Liaise with candidates to confirm availability, site requirements, and mobilisation details
  • Coordinate inductions, site bookings, medicals, and compliance requirements
  • Maintain accurate records of workforce movements and project allocations
  • Work collaboratively across recruitment and mobilisation teams as priorities shift
  • Support high-volume workloads in line with shutdown and project timeframes
  • Ensure all mobilisation activities align with client and site compliance requirements

 

Essential Skills, Tickets, and Experience:

  • Proven experience in recruitment and/or mobilisation within the mining or resources sector
  • Strong experience working with Rio Tinto mobilisation processes, systems, and inductions
  • Confident communicator with the ability to liaise with candidates over the phone
  • Ability to manage high-volume workloads in a fast-paced environment
  • Strong organisational skills with high attention to detail
  • Flexible and adaptable, with the ability to support multiple functions as required
  • Intermediate computer skills including Microsoft Office Suite

Recruitment

Our recruiters will review your application against our clients needs and may contact you to go through our recruitment process. This may include an interview, reference checks, pre-employment medicals, verification of documents including tickets/licences and right to work in Australia.

Mobilisation

Once the client has approved your application, you will commence our mobilisation process. The requirements of your mobilisation may differ depending on the job and industry. Your dedicated recruiter and/or mobilisation officer will step you through the process.
